Moorside Station is well-equipped with ticket machines that are accessible to all, ensuring a hassle-free start to your travel experience. While there isn't a ticket office, these machines allow for quick and easy purchase of rail tickets. Unfortunately, the station doesn't provide facilities for online ticket collection or smartcard validation, so ensure you have your ticket ready before boarding.
Accessibility is a crucial focus at Moorside, although the station presents some challenges with a category C rating. Access requires navigating a small step and 34 steps down to the island platform. Support is available on-site with induction loops and portable ramps for train access to assist those with mobility needs. If you need further assistance, the helpful staff are on hand during operating hours, and additional information can be gleaned from the helpline.

Catford Bridge station provides a host of facilities designed to make your travel experience more convenient. The ticket office is open Monday through Saturday from 06:10 to 19:30, and on Sundays from 08:40 to 16:40, ensuring you have ample time to purchase and collect your tickets. Ticket machines, including accessible ones, are located conveniently on the forecourt and platform 1, allowing for easy access to services. Induction loops and smartcard validators are also present, providing additional ease for ticket transactions.
The station maintains good security with CCTV cameras in place. However, be prepared as there are no refreshment facilities, ATMs, or waiting room offices at the station. If you need a quick snack or cash, make sure to plan ahead before your visit. For cyclists, there are 10 bicycle storage spaces, complete with stands and sheltered parking, although at your own risk, as no CCTV is present in this area.
Catford Bridge is partially accessible, with step-free access available across the station. It's important to note that while there is interchange via road and steep paths, stepped access is still an option via the footbridge. If you require additional assistance, staff help is available within the station's operating hours. Customer help points and induction loops can be found throughout the station.
For those with impaired mobility, a set down/pick-up point is available, but there are no accessible taxis or designated parking spaces at this location. If you require extra assistance, the station can arrange for a mobile assistance team or even a complementary taxi service to a nearby station with comprehensive facilities, ensuring seamless transfers for all passengers.
Traveling beyond Catford Bridge is made easy with a variety of transport options. For those heading towards Lewisham, bus stop R on Catford Road is your go-to point, while those traveling towards Hayes can catch their ride from bus stop M.
